Output 8e900109b5326cbb9468e2176f910f124f53dbd534a4cc21e70af164fd6a556d:3

value
1427119
script pubkey
OP_0 OP_PUSHBYTES_20 8dd4ef28275b63d6b75459b2693b8a8a3a0e1b05
address
bc1q3h2w72p8td3add65txexjwu23gaquxc9ytuzjt
transaction
8e900109b5326cbb9468e2176f910f124f53dbd534a4cc21e70af164fd6a556d
spent
true